envsetup.mk revision b47d4e9cf12f734fa592ca1f9d093556d253cd38
1# Variables we check:
2#     HOST_BUILD_TYPE = { release debug }
3#     TARGET_BUILD_TYPE = { release debug }
4# and we output a bunch of variables, see the case statement at
5# the bottom for the full list
6#     OUT_DIR is also set to "out" if it's not already set.
7#         this allows you to set it to somewhere else if you like
8#     SCAN_EXCLUDE_DIRS is an optional, whitespace separated list of
9#         directories that will also be excluded from full checkout tree
10#         searches for source or make files, in addition to OUT_DIR.
11#         This can be useful if you set OUT_DIR to be a different directory
12#         than other outputs of your build system.
13
14# Returns all words in $1 up to and including $2
15define find_and_earlier
16  $(strip $(if $(1),
17    $(firstword $(1))
18    $(if $(filter $(firstword $(1)),$(2)),,
19      $(call find_and_earlier,$(wordlist 2,$(words $(1)),$(1)),$(2)))))
20endef
21
22#$(warning $(call find_and_earlier,A B C,A))
23#$(warning $(call find_and_earlier,A B C,B))
24#$(warning $(call find_and_earlier,A B C,C))
25#$(warning $(call find_and_earlier,A B C,D))
26
27define version-list
28$(1)PR1 $(1)PD1 $(1)PD2 $(1)PM1 $(1)PM2
29endef
30
31ALL_VERSIONS := O P Q R S T U V W X Y Z
32ALL_VERSIONS := $(foreach v,$(ALL_VERSIONS),$(call version-list,$(v)))
33
34# Filters ALL_VERSIONS down to the range [$1, $2], and errors if $1 > $2 or $3 is
35# not in [$1, $2]
36# $(1): min platform version
37# $(2): max platform version
38# $(3): default platform version
39define allowed-platform-versions
40$(strip \
41  $(if $(filter $(ALL_VERSIONS),$(1)),,
42    $(error Invalid MIN_PLATFORM_VERSION '$(1)'))
43  $(if $(filter $(ALL_VERSIONS),$(2)),,
44    $(error Invalid MAX_PLATFORM_VERSION '$(2)'))
45  $(if $(filter $(ALL_VERSIONS),$(3)),,
46    $(error Invalid DEFAULT_PLATFORM_VERSION '$(3)'))
47
48  $(eval allowed_versions_ := $(call find_and_earlier,$(ALL_VERSIONS),$(2)))
49
50  $(if $(filter $(allowed_versions_),$(1)),,
51    $(error MIN_PLATFORM_VERSION '$(1)' must be before MAX_PLATFORM_VERSION '$(2)'))
52
53  $(eval allowed_versions_ := $(1) \
54    $(filter-out $(call find_and_earlier,$(allowed_versions_),$(1)),$(allowed_versions_)))
55
56  $(if $(filter $(allowed_versions_),$(3)),,
57    $(error DEFAULT_PLATFORM_VERSION '$(3)' must be between MIN_PLATFORM_VERSION '$(1)' and MAX_PLATFORM_VERSION '$(2)'))
58
59  $(allowed_versions_))
60endef
61
62#$(warning $(call allowed-platform-versions,OPR1,PPR1,OPR1))
63#$(warning $(call allowed-platform-versions,OPM1,PPR1,OPR1))
64
65# Set up version information.
66include $(BUILD_SYSTEM)/version_defaults.mk
67
68ENABLED_VERSIONS := $(call find_and_earlier,$(ALL_VERSIONS),$(TARGET_PLATFORM_VERSION))
69
70$(foreach v,$(ENABLED_VERSIONS), \
71  $(eval IS_AT_LEAST_$(v) := true))
72

109# ---------------------------------------------------------------
110# Set up configuration for host machine.  We don't do cross-
111# compiles except for arm/mips, so the HOST is whatever we are
112# running on
113
114UNAME := $(shell uname -sm)
115
116# HOST_OS
117ifneq (,$(findstring Linux,$(UNAME)))
118  HOST_OS := linux
119endif
120ifneq (,$(findstring Darwin,$(UNAME)))
121  HOST_OS := darwin
122endif
123ifneq (,$(findstring Macintosh,$(UNAME)))
124  HOST_OS := darwin
125endif
126
127HOST_OS_EXTRA:=$(shell python -c "import platform; print(platform.platform())")
128
129# BUILD_OS is the real host doing the build.
130BUILD_OS := $(HOST_OS)
131
132HOST_CROSS_OS :=
133# We can cross-build Windows binaries on Linux
134ifeq ($(HOST_OS),linux)
135HOST_CROSS_OS := windows
136HOST_CROSS_ARCH := x86
137HOST_CROSS_2ND_ARCH := x86_64
1382ND_HOST_CROSS_IS_64_BIT := true
139endif
140
141ifeq ($(HOST_OS),)
142$(error Unable to determine HOST_OS from uname -sm: $(UNAME)!)
143endif
144
145# HOST_ARCH
146ifneq (,$(findstring x86_64,$(UNAME)))
147  HOST_ARCH := x86_64
148  HOST_2ND_ARCH := x86
149  HOST_IS_64_BIT := true
150else
151ifneq (,$(findstring i686,$(UNAME))$(findstring x86,$(UNAME)))
152$(error Building on a 32-bit x86 host is not supported: $(UNAME)!)
153endif
154endif
155
156BUILD_ARCH := $(HOST_ARCH)
157BUILD_2ND_ARCH := $(HOST_2ND_ARCH)
158
159ifeq ($(HOST_ARCH),)
160$(error Unable to determine HOST_ARCH from uname -sm: $(UNAME)!)
161endif
162
163# the host build defaults to release, and it must be release or debug
164ifeq ($(HOST_BUILD_TYPE),)
165HOST_BUILD_TYPE := release
166endif
167
168ifneq ($(HOST_BUILD_TYPE),release)
169ifneq ($(HOST_BUILD_TYPE),debug)
170$(error HOST_BUILD_TYPE must be either release or debug, not '$(HOST_BUILD_TYPE)')
171endif
172endif
173
174# We don't want to move all the prebuilt host tools to a $(HOST_OS)-x86_64 dir.
175HOST_PREBUILT_ARCH := x86
176# This is the standard way to name a directory containing prebuilt host
177# objects. E.g., prebuilt/$(HOST_PREBUILT_TAG)/cc
178HOST_PREBUILT_TAG := $(BUILD_OS)-$(HOST_PREBUILT_ARCH)
179
